What documents are required for identity verification?

For full verification of your profile, you will be asked to upload a valid identity document and a recent proof of address (less than 3 months old).

For the proof of identity, we accept the following documents:

• European national identity card.

• Biometric passport (all nationalities).

• Residence permit in France, Sweden, Denmark, Norway, or Finland

For the proof of address:

• Invoice.

• Rent receipt.

• Tax certificate.

• Work permit.

The expired documents, residence permit application receipts and attestations from asylum seekers are not accepted.

What is a virtual card?

A virtual card is a dematerialised version of your bank card. It functions like a physical card with a card number, a validity date and a CVV code, but it only exists in digital form.

Why was my withdrawal refused?

If your withdrawal is refused, please check the following points:

– Is your balance sufficient? As the card is prepaid, it must be topped up before use.

– Is the card locked? If so, unlock it by text message.

– Is the PIN code correct? If necessary, request a new PIN code.

Why does the verification of my identity fail?

Identity verification often fails because of the quality of the photos provided. Here are some tips for success:

– Take your photos in a well-lit place, on a flat surface, with no reflections.

– Make sure that the identity document is completely visible and that it is properly accepted (passport, European identity card, residence permit).

– Check that your face is clear and the camera is at eye level, and that you are the only person taking the selfie.

– Don’t forget to also provide a valid and recent proof of address (less than 3 months old), such as a bill, rent receipt or tax certificate. This proof of address is essential to complete the verification of your identity.

If, despite several attempts, the verification fails, our teams will take over and contact you for further information or to validate your identity manually.
